Getting there & planning your visit
Burnham Thorpe War Memorial is located in Norfolk, postcode PE31 8HL. The nearest railway station is Wells-on-Sea, approximately 7.5 km away. Entry to the memorial is free.

Heritage listing
Details MATERIALS: limestone. DESCRIPTION: Burnham Thorpe War Memorial is located within the churchyard of the Church of All Saints. It consists of a tall Latin cross on a tapering octagonal shaft with a carved collar. The shaft rises from an octagonal plinth with a moulded base. The memorial is set upon a two-stepped base and stands some 3.6m high. A raised inscription in ornate medieval-style script runs around the top of plinth which reads SONS OF/ THIS PLACE/ LET THIS/ OF YOU BE/ SAID THAT/ YOU WHO/ LIVE ARE/ WORTHY OF/ YOUR DEAD. Below this are the names of the fallen in incised black-painted plainer lettering followed by their regiment and date of death. There is also a band of carved crosses, one under each name. A further inscription in black-painted incised medieval-style script runs around the moulded base of the plinth LOOKING/ INTO/ JESUS/ THE/ CAPTAIN/ AND/ PERFECTER/ OF OUR/ FAITH.
